Mysql 如何在ubuntu中从终端创建.sql文件

Mysql 如何在ubuntu中从终端创建.sql文件,mysql,sql,ubuntu,Mysql,Sql,Ubuntu,我已经创建了一个使用数据库的项目,用mysql编写。要提交此项目,我需要创建一个.sql文件。 我没有使用workbench。有谁能指导我如何使用终端制作.sql文件吗。我已经用终端创建了我所有的数据库。我正在ubuntu上工作 nysqldump -u db_username -p database_name > database_name.sql 然后输入,它将询问密码,输入密码,然后点击回车,它将为您创建.sql文件 下面是我的ubuntu机器中的一个例子 abhik@ubuntu

我已经创建了一个使用数据库的项目,用mysql编写。要提交此项目,我需要创建一个.sql文件。 我没有使用workbench。有谁能指导我如何使用终端制作.sql文件吗。我已经用终端创建了我所有的数据库。我正在ubuntu上工作

nysqldump -u db_username -p database_name > database_name.sql
然后输入,它将询问密码,输入密码,然后点击回车,它将为您创建.sql文件

下面是我的ubuntu机器中的一个例子

abhik@ubuntu-desktop:~$ mysqldump -u root -p test >test.sql
Enter password: 
abhik@ubuntu-desktop:~$ 
我当前在桌面文件夹中,因此如果要导出,文件将保存在桌面下:

 mysqldump -u mysql_user -p DATABASE_NAME > backup.sql
要导入:

 mysql -u mysql_user -p DATABASE < backup.sql

要从终端创建转储文件吗?谢谢。但当我按enter键时,它只会在提示中给我一个箭头…类似这样的内容->确保您在执行转储时未登录mysql,它需要不登录。请参阅我的更新。欢迎。。如果这个答案有用,请投赞成票。干杯-